Mitch McConnell and Senate Republicans are abusing their confirmation power to rig the courts. Their scheme hinges on the increasingly far-fetched idea that Republicans will take back the White House in 2016. If Democrats take back the Senate majority in 2016, McConnell and the GOP will regret their plan because Democrats aren’t going to forget, and payback will be severe. Senate Republicans are proving that they have no interest in governing. Their only concern is preventing President Obama from getting anything done.
